UCL enhance inventory tracking, quality control, and dispatch operations with TransLution Software

UCL, a diversified agri-processor and sugar producer based in Dalton, KwaZulu-Natal, has successfully implemented TransLution Software at their Sugar Packing Plant (SPP) and Sugar Repacking Plant (SRP). The primary objective of this implementation was to enhance inventory tracking, quality control, and dispatch operations ahead of the 2026 sugar harvest season. The project focused on improving key processes such as inventory receipting and palletising, hourly quality control data capture, and dispatch and compliance control.

TransLution Software was integrated to support several critical functions. Automated inventory receipting was implemented to receipt bulk bags and pallets at SPP and SRP under unique QR-coded labels, enforcing multi-trip bag reuse limits along the way. Additionally, hourly QC data capture was introduced to record batch-level quality results, such as POL, colour, and moisture, and to automatically classify stock as saleable, concession, or unsaleable, triggering the correct warehouse movement. The system also includes dispatch validation, which checks truck registration numbers and loading mass against sales orders and automatically generates Dispatch Notes, Invoices, and Certificates of Analysis.

This implementation aims to boost operational efficiency, reduce data entry errors, and accelerate the release of stock from quality control to saleable inventory. UCL anticipates that these improvements will lead to stronger dispatch compliance, reduced administrative workload, and improved traceability and customer confidence.

UCL and TransLution are already planning a Phase 2, which is expected to include weighbridge integration and raw materials warehouse management.

About UCL

UCL Company (Pty) Ltd, based in KwaZulu-Natal, South Africa, has grown from a wattle bark milling company in 1924 to a large-scale enterprise specialising in the manufacture of wattle tannin extracts, sugar and pine lumber. In addition, the company operates 6500 hectares of farm land and runs a Trading division for the supply of agricultural input materials. UCL’s operations primarily serve the interests of its raw material suppliers who are also the company’s shareholders.
